Claims
- 1. Apparatus for calcining materials comprising:
- (a) an upstanding hollow shaft kiln, through which the material to be calcined passes downwardly by the force of gravity, defining a plurality of zones including an upper preheating zone, a first calcining zone having a defined length, a second calcining zone having a defined length relative to the length of said first calcining zone with said defined length being approximately twice the length of said first calcining zone, and a material cooling zone;
- (b) air tight charging means at the top of said kiln communicating with supply means for charging said kiln with said material to be calcined;
- (c) means for selectively introducing combustion air into a lower portion of said cooling zone from outside said kiln comprising a plurality of adjustable ducts located at the bottom of said material cooling zone;
- (d) a collector channel adjacent the upper portion of said cooling zone and the lower portion of said second calcining zone;
- (e) a plurality of burners located intermediate said first calcining zone and said second calcining zone in position to inject burnt gases therefrom into said kiln;
- (f) first flow means communicating said collector channel with said burner and including gas conveying means for conveying gases from said collector channel to said burners and creating a negative pressure within said collector channel to convey a minor portion of said burnt gases injected into said kiln downwardly through said second calcining zone in co-current flow with said material to said collector channel for intermingling with said combustion air and recycling to said burners, said minor portion comprising about 20 to 25% of the burnt gases injected to the kiln from said burner; and
- (g) second flow means communicating with an upper portion of said preheating zone for exhausting burnt gases therefrom and creating a negative pressure within said upper portion of said preheating zone to convey a major portion of said burnt gases injected into said kiln upwardly through said first calcining zone and said preheating zone in counter current flow to said material.
- 2. A process for calcining materials comprising the steps of:
- (a) introducing material to be calcined at the upper end of a hollow shaft kiln through which said material passes downwardly by the force of gravity through a plurality of zones in series including an upper pre-heating zone, a first calcining zone, a second calcining zone having a length approximately twice that of said first calcining zone, and a material cooling zone;
- (b) selectively introducing combustion air to said kiln through the lower end of said material cooling zone;
- (c) injecting burnt gases resulting from the combustion of a fuel and said combustion air into said kiln intermediate said first calcining zone and said second calcining zone;
- (d) subjecting said material to be calcined successively during downward movement thereof through said zones to a counter-current flow of a major portion of said burnt gases in said upper preheating zone and said first calcining zone, a a co-current flow of a minor portion of said burnt gases in said second calcining zone, said minor portion comprising about 20 to 25% of the burnt gases injected into said kiln, and a counter-current flow of said combustion air in said material cooling zone;
- (e) withdrawing substantially the entire quantity of combustion air introduced into said material cooling zone and subbstanially the entire quantity of said minor portion of said burnt gases and said combustion air from said kiln shaft intermediate said second calcining zone and said matcrial cooling zone and utilizing the mixture thereof for said combustion of a fuel;
- (f) removing said major portion of the burnt gases from said upper part of said kiln; and
- (g) discharging the calcined product at the lower end of said material cooling zone.
